Beaming

NFC
NFC (Near Field Communication) allows data exchange when
you touch your device with another compatible device. This
is used for applications such as Android Beam and S Beam.

Android Beam
When Android Beam is activated, you can beam application
content to another NFC-capable device by holding the
devices close together. You can beam browser pages,
YouTube videos, contacts, and more. This option is best for
smaller file transfers.

Using Android Beam
1. Turn Android Beam On.
2. Launch the desired feature or application or browse to
the desired web page.
3. Place the phone back-to-back with the device to
receive your "beamed" content, then touch the screen
on the phone. The receiving device prompts the user to
accept your "beamed" content.
4. Once the user of the receiving device accepts your
"beamed" content, it displays on the screen of that
device.
